You type the same phrases dozens of times daily: your email address, home address, meeting confirmations, even "On my way!" What if three keystrokes could replace thirty? Apple's built-in text shortcuts—officially called Text Replacement—transform repetitive typing into instant expansions across iPhone, iPad, and Mac. No third-party apps required. Once configured, these personalized shortcuts work system-wide in Messages, Mail, Notes, and every app accepting text input, saving professionals an estimated 15–20 minutes daily. A single email signature typed ten times daily adds up to nearly an hour monthly. Text shortcuts eliminate this friction by converting abbreviated triggers—like "sig" or "addr"—into full phrases with a single spacebar tap.
